Precharge resistor

I just bought these twist-in 48v bulbs for one of my old legacy style automotive testlights, just tried it out the other day and it works great. The light is great because it also gives that visual indicator to let you know when light is dimmed to nothing, caps are charged.


I tested the light on a 58v battery charging on absorption and it works fine, looks like it could go even brighter if I went to higher voltages. Also still lights up at 24v too, a little dimmer.

I checked the ohms on the new bulb and it shows about 91 Ω
